> I'm in devMode, enabled logMissingProperties and expect to see missing 
> property warning in the log. I was surprised that I can't get the missing 
> property log even if logMissingProperties is set true. The application run 
> smoothly and skip the missing property - as expected though.
> In another run, I enabled both logMissingProperties and 
> throwExceptionOnFailure. This time the application crash at the missing 
> property and I can get both logs and exception.
> After I dive deeper using debugger, I convince myself the config is good, 
> since devMode and logMissingProperties are true at runtime in OgnlValueStack.
> I was confused, why we can't get missing property log without throwing 
> OgnlException? 
> Are we able to enter handleOgnlException(String expr, boolean 
> throwExceptionOnFailure, OgnlException e)  at all if throwExceptionOnFailure 
> is false, in which my expected log is written?
